
Uncanny Stories
This compilation of Sir Arthur Conan Doyle's short stories introduces you to stories that you will read with admiration but also with chills.
These are the short stories of Sir Arthur Conan Doyle, who created the world's most famous detective, Sherlock Holmes. Doyle, who draws the reader into the mysteries of the twilight zone and does this by adding a literary flavor, also maintains his obsession with reality. Real places make the stories more believable. While reading it, you know that it is fiction and you cannot help but ask the question "I wonder?" As the flashlight bent over him, it was as if an invisible hand had tightly closed both of Kennedy's eyes. He had never experienced such darkness before. It was as if the darkness was weighing on him and suffocating him. It was like a solid obstacle, preventing his body from moving. He wanted to stretch it out and push the darkness away from him."
